Output 8a1b29a753dd36f6ce61073fc4e34cd8a048148363c7327c742075427638ea79:1

value
17640027
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16d4fd249e1b923c25fb8b90567ff638d622b4a0 OP_EQUALVERIFY OP_CHECKSIG
address
135j1wmfNeCsAf13eygTwjMn8VS8CdaRau
transaction
8a1b29a753dd36f6ce61073fc4e34cd8a048148363c7327c742075427638ea79
confirmations
458400
spent
true